- Buffering: This is when the video pauses to load. It's usually caused by a slow internet connection. To fix it, try restarting your modem and router, moving closer to your Wi-Fi router, or reducing the number of devices using your internet.
- Video Quality: If the video quality is poor, make sure you have the correct settings in the app. Also, your internet speed might be the culprit. Consider upgrading your internet plan if you consistently experience low video quality.
- Audio Issues: If you're having audio problems, such as no sound or distorted audio, check your device's volume settings, and make sure the audio settings in the app are correct. You might also want to try restarting the app or your device.
- App Crashes/Freezes: If the app is crashing or freezing, try closing and reopening the app or restarting your streaming device. Make sure your app is updated to the latest version. If the problem persists, try uninstalling and reinstalling the app.
- Geographic Restrictions: Some content may be restricted based on your location. Make sure you're in an area where CBS News is available. If you're traveling, you might need to use a VPN to access CBS News from another region.
- Use a Wired Connection: If possible, connect your streaming device directly to your router with an Ethernet cable. This provides a more stable and faster internet connection than Wi-Fi.
- Close Unused Apps and Programs: To free up resources, close any apps or programs running in the background on your device. This can help improve performance and reduce buffering.
- Update Your Software: Make sure your streaming device and the apps you're using are updated to the latest versions. Updates often include bug fixes and performance improvements.
- Adjust Your Video Settings: Experiment with the video quality settings in your streaming app. You might need to lower the quality to reduce buffering if your internet speed is slow.
- Use a Streaming Stick: Streaming sticks, such as Roku or Fire TV, offer a dedicated streaming experience. They're often more reliable than using a smart TV's built-in apps.
- Optimize Your Home Network: Ensure your Wi-Fi network is optimized for streaming. Place your router in a central location, and avoid obstructions that can weaken the signal. Consider upgrading your router to a newer model with better range and speed.

Official CBS News Platforms
Let's start with the most direct route: the official CBS News platforms. The CBS News website and app are your go-to places for free, live news coverage. With CBSN, you can watch live news, breaking news coverage, and on-demand video clips. The CBS News app is available on all major streaming devices. This includes smartphones, tablets, smart TVs, and streaming media players like Roku, Apple TV, and Fire TV. This makes it super easy to catch the news on any screen you want. The CBS News website and app also offer on-demand video content, including news clips, interviews, and special reports. This is great if you want to catch up on what you missed or dive deeper into a specific story. Plus, it's free. This is a big win for budget-conscious viewers who still want to stay informed. However, remember that the free version of CBS News platforms might include ads. So, if you're looking for an ad-free experience, you might need to explore other options or consider a subscription service.
Live TV Streaming Services
If you're already subscribed to a live TV streaming service, you're likely in luck. Several major services include CBS in their channel lineups. For instance, Paramount+ is the most obvious option since it's owned by CBS's parent company, Paramount Global. It provides live access to CBS News, plus a ton of on-demand content, including movies and shows. If you are not into Paramount's content, then there are other options like Y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, and FuboTV. These services offer a wide range of channels, including CBS, alongside other local and cable channels. They're a great choice if you want a complete TV package with live news, sports, and entertainment. Before you sign up, check their channel lineups to ensure they carry CBS in your area. Also, consider the pricing and features, such as DVR storage and simultaneous streams, to find the best fit for your needs. Subscription prices vary, so compare different plans to determine which one offers the best value for your viewing habits.
